2025 Chevrolet Silverado 1500 Interior Review
Now, let’s talk about the inside of this beast. The 2025 Silverado 1500 isn’t just about muscle—it’s got some brains, too. Depending on how many friends (or tools) you want to bring along for the ride, you can choose between the Regular Cab, which seats three, or the Double Cab and Crew Cab, which can seat up to six. Got a lot of stuff? Of course you do. Thankfully, there’s smart storage all around to keep your gear in check and your cab clutter-free.
You’ll get a classic front bench seat as standard, but if you want to add a bit of luxury to your rugged ride, some trims let you upgrade to front captain’s chairs. Vinyl comes standard, but if you’re into a little more style and comfort, the higher trims throw in features like:
- Leather upholstery that makes your truck feel like a VIP lounge
- Heated and ventilated front seats so you can battle winter and summer with ease
- Power-adjustable front seats to fine-tune your driving throne
- Heated front seats, because cold mornings are for coffee, not cold seats

2025 Chevrolet Silverado 1500 Performance
The 2025 Chevrolet Silverado 1500 doesn't just show up to do the job—it shows up with options. Under the hood, you’ve got four powertrain choices that’ll make you feel like a kid in a candy store—if the candy were turbocharged and capable of towing a small house. Here's what you’re working with.
- 6.2-liter V8: For when you need to summon 420 horses and 460 lb-ft of torque. Available on trims like the RST, Trail Boss, LTZ, High Country, and ZR2, this engine is for those who believe "too much power" is a phrase best left unspoken.
- 5.3-liter V8: If the 6.2 seems like overkill (but not by much), the 355-horsepower 5.3-liter V8 with 383 lb-ft of torque will handle just about anything you throw at it. Found on the WT, LT, RST, Trail Boss, and High Country, this engine offers plenty of muscle without flexing too hard.
- Turbodiesel 3.0-liter I-6: This 305-horsepower diesel engine with 495 lb-ft of torque is for those who like torque by the truckload. Available on select trims like LT, RST, Trail Boss, LTZ, High Country, and ZR2, it's all about pulling power, with the added bonus of bragging rights.
- 2.7-liter 4-cylinder: Yep, it’s a 4-cylinder, but don’t let that fool you—this 310-horsepower engine cranks out 430 lb-ft of torque. Found on the WT, Custom, LT, RST, and Trail Boss trims, it's proof that good things come in smaller packages—just not too small.
Whether you’re working with the smooth 8-speed automatic or the extra-smooth 10-speed, you’re in for a ride that’s as easy as pie. And, because Chevy knows that sometimes you need all four wheels pulling their weight, you’ve got rear-wheel drive standard with an optional four-wheel drive setup for when things get dirty.
Now, about that towing—you can haul up to 13,300 pounds, which is basically enough to tow a literal parade float. And the payload? Try 2,260 pounds, so don’t be shy about loading it up. Three bed options (Long Bed at 8 feet, Standard Bed at 6 feet 6 inches, or Short Bed at 5 feet 8 inches) means you can configure your Silverado to fit your life—or at least your next big project.

Standard Technology Features
- 7-inch Touchscreen
- Two USB Ports
- Wireless Apple CarPlay® and Android Auto™
- 3.5-inch Digital Driver Information Display
- Two- or Six-Speaker Stereo (Depending on body style)

Available Safety Features
- Forward Automatic Emergency Braking
- Rear-Seat Alert
- Lane-Keep Assist
- Teen Driver
- Lane-Departure Warning
